Getting certified
It can be of huge benefit in many countries to have got certified in a native English speaking country before travelling abroad to teach English as a Foreign Language. While this isn't a requirement in Israel, it will certainly help you when it comes time to finding a job.
Another requirement for teaching English in Israel is to have a University degree. The subject is really unimportant; what matters is the fact that you have graduated from a University (or if a North American, from college).
The TESOL organisation in Tel Aviv is one of the most highly regarded English-teaching organisations in Israel. The English Teacher Network in Israel (www.etni.org.il) can also give more very useful advice on TEFL in Israel. This is a vibrant site with lots of job ads on their forums, well worth a look.
Finding a position
There is a great need for English Language teachers in Israel as evidenced by the above mentioned site. Most positions will be within more well-off areas, predominantly middle class to upper class neighbourhoods. English is hugely popular as a subject, being taught at all levels and to all ages. You could end up teaching everything from General English to Conversational English to Financial and Business English.
In the same middle class areas, you’lll find that a large percentage of children have private English lessons frequently on a one to one basis. Teaching privately can allow for more flexible working and it can give you more control over what you teach and how you teach. However, within the school systems there are benefits too. Pay is generally higher and you have more job security in general.
Business English teaching is another possibility within Israel. Speaking English is highly important in many areas of business and industry in Israel. Many businesses and corporations in Israel deal with the Western world on a frequent basis, and employees who speak English are an absolute necessity. A corporation may hire you on a job-by-job basis, or even take you on as an in-house trainer, where you'll be expected to teach English to employees one-on-one or in a group setting.
What to expect
The pay in Israel can be rather low compared to other Middle Eastern countries. Nonetheless there are opportunities to increase your worth by going on further training courses, attending conferences or going to workshops. This can greatly increase your value as a teacher and result in pay raises down the road. A resourceful teacher will take any such opportunities that come along and will learn quickly how to increase his or her worth on the job.
The majority of schools who take on TEFL teachers in Israel will offer teacher's housing, and you should take advantage of this situation particularly if you are located in a large city, as housing may be expensive and difficult to find.
